The Rise of Tomorrow: Next-Gen Talent Shaping Sports’ Future

The world of professional sports is a perpetual cycle of evolution, constantly replenished and redefined by an influx of next-gen talents. These prodigious athletes, often possessing skills and perspectives far beyond their years, are not merely following in the footsteps of legends; they are actively reshaping the game, pushing boundaries, and demanding new paradigms for training, fan engagement, and even the economics of sport. From the youngest phenoms dazzling on global stages to the emerging stars disrupting established hierarchies, next-gen talent represents the very future of athletic competition. This comprehensive article delves into the transformative impact of these rising stars, exploring the factors fueling their accelerated development, the innovative pathways they traverse, the challenges they face, and the profound influence they exert on sport’s strategic, commercial, and cultural landscape. We’ll uncover why identifying, nurturing, and integrating this new wave of athletes is paramount for the sustained vibrancy and evolution of every major sport.

Factors Fueling Accelerated Development

The emergence of next-gen talent at increasingly younger ages is not accidental. It’s the result of a complex interplay of scientific advancements, specialized training, and a changing ecosystem that nurtures early potential.

Key Drivers of Accelerated Talent Development:

  1. Early Specialization (Debated but Prevalent): While controversial, many aspiring next-gen talents begin specializing in their chosen sport at a very young age. This intense focus, combined with year-round participation, allows for rapid skill acquisition and mastery of sport-specific techniques. However, it also raises concerns about burnout and diverse physical development.
  2. Advanced Coaching Methodologies: Coaching has evolved from traditional, often intuitive methods to scientifically informed approaches. Coaches now leverage biomechanics, sports psychology, and data analytics to design highly specific training programs that optimize skill development, strength, and conditioning from an early age. Access to specialized coaching is a significant advantage.
  3. Technological Integration in Training: From wearable trackers monitoring physiological responses to high-speed cameras analyzing technique and virtual reality simulations for skill refinement, technology plays a crucial role. These tools provide immediate, objective feedback, allowing for accelerated learning and precise adjustments.
  4. Globalized Talent Identification: Scouting networks are now truly global. Teams and academies actively search for talent across continents, identifying promising young athletes from diverse backgrounds. This expanded talent pool increases competition and pushes overall standards higher.
  5. Professionalized Youth Academies: Major sports organizations and clubs operate sophisticated youth academies that provide comprehensive development pathways, offering elite coaching, academic support, and access to state-of-the-art facilities. These academies serve as crucial incubators for future stars.
  6. Nutritional Science and Sports Medicine: A deeper understanding of pediatric sports nutrition and sports medicine ensures young athletes are properly fueled for growth and performance, while proactive injury prevention strategies protect their developing bodies. Early access to sports dietitians and physiotherapists is common.

How Next-Gen Talent Changes the Game

Next-gen talents aren’t just faster or stronger; they often bring innovative playing styles, tactical approaches, and a fearlessness that forces established players and coaches to adapt.

Ways Next-Gen Talent Reshapes Sports:

  1. Innovative Playing Styles: Young athletes, unburdened by traditional thinking, often develop unique and unconventional playing styles. They are more willing to experiment with new techniques or strategies that might have been dismissed by older generations, forcing defensive and offensive adaptations across the league.
  2. Higher Pace and Intensity: Many next-gen talents bring an unparalleled level of athleticism, speed, and intensity, particularly in sports like basketball and soccer. This forces the game to be played at a faster pace, physically challenging older players and demanding higher fitness levels from everyone.
  3. Skill Expansion: With access to specialized training from a young age, these athletes often possess a broader and more refined skill set than previous generations. They might be proficient in multiple aspects of the game (e.g., a big man who can shoot threes in basketball, a defender who can initiate attacks in soccer).
  4. Influence on Tactics: Coaches develop new tactical schemes to maximize the unique abilities of their next-gen stars. A single dominant talent can force opposing teams to fundamentally alter their defensive strategies, impacting the entire league’s tactical evolution.
  5. Technological Adoption: These are digital natives who are often more comfortable and adept at utilizing advanced training technology, data analytics, and virtual reality tools, leading to more efficient and personalized development.
  6. “Positionless” Play: In many team sports, next-gen talents contribute to a trend of “positionless” play, where players are versatile enough to excel in multiple roles, blurring traditional positional boundaries and creating more dynamic team compositions.

The Spotlight’s Glare

The ascent of next-gen talent often comes with immediate, intense media scrutiny, unprecedented levels of fame, and the challenging task of managing public expectations.

Managing Fame and Scrutiny for Young Stars:

  1. Social Media Magnification: Growing up in the age of social media, these athletes’ every move is documented and scrutinized. A single misstep can go viral, leading to immense pressure and public judgment. They often have huge followings before even turning professional.
  2. Early Brand Endorsements: The immense marketability of young stars leads to lucrative endorsement deals early in their careers. While financially beneficial, this adds responsibilities and potential distractions, requiring professional management.
  3. Media Training and Public Relations: To navigate the relentless media attention, many next-gen talents receive extensive media training to handle interviews, public appearances, and manage their personal brand effectively.
  4. Mental Health Challenges: The sudden fame, immense pressure, and constant scrutiny can take a toll on mental health. Support systems, including sports psychologists, are crucial for helping these young athletes cope with the demands of their elevated status.
  5. Balancing Personal Life and Professional Demands: Maintaining a semblance of normal personal life while fulfilling demanding professional obligations and being under constant public observation is a significant challenge for young stars.
  6. Expectation Management: Fans and media often place unrealistic expectations on next-gen talents, predicting legendary careers. Managing these external expectations without succumbing to pressure is vital for long-term psychological well-being.

Commercial Impact and Market Value

The arrival of next-gen talents is an economic boon for sports leagues, teams, and associated industries, driving revenue and reshaping market dynamics.

Economic Influence of Next-Gen Talent:

  1. Increased Fan Engagement and Viewership: The excitement generated by rising stars attracts new fans, particularly younger demographics, and increases overall viewership and attendance, boosting media rights and ticket sales.
  2. Merchandise Sales: Jerseys, apparel, and merchandise featuring next-gen talents are instant bestsellers, generating significant revenue for teams and leagues. Their popularity translates directly to commercial success.
  3. Sponsorship and Endorsement Value: Brands flock to sign young, marketable stars, viewing them as long-term investments with immense influence over consumer trends. These endorsement deals become a significant revenue stream for players and a marketing tool for brands.
  4. Franchise Value Appreciation: Teams that successfully draft or acquire top next-gen talent often see a significant increase in their franchise valuation, as they become more attractive investments with long-term competitive potential.
  5. Salary Growth and Contract Deals: The market for top young talent is incredibly competitive, leading to escalating player salaries and record-breaking contracts as teams vie to secure their services for the long term.
  6. Impact on Media Rights and Broadcast Deals: The presence of exciting young stars makes leagues more attractive to broadcasters and streaming services, driving up the value of media rights deals for the entire sport.
  7. Youth Sports Participation Boom: The inspiration provided by next-gen talents often leads to increased youth participation in their respective sports, creating a larger talent pool and boosting the grassroots sports industry.

Crossing Borders and Cultures

Next-gen talent transcends geographical boundaries, playing a crucial role in the globalization of sports and fostering cross-cultural connections.

Global Reach and Impact of Young Stars:

  1. Diversification of Talent Pools: Global scouting initiatives mean that next-gen talents emerge from every corner of the world, leading to more diverse rosters and increasing the global representation within major leagues.
  2. International Fan Bases: As players from different countries rise to stardom, they bring with them their national fan bases, expanding the global reach and popularity of leagues and teams.
  3. Cross-Cultural Appeal: The universal language of athletic excellence allows next-gen talents to resonate with fans from diverse cultural backgrounds, fostering global camaraderie around shared sporting passion.
  4. Promotion of Sports in Emerging Markets: A successful next-gen talent from a non-traditional sports market can spark immense interest in their home country, inspiring new generations and driving investment in local sports infrastructure.
  5. Exhibition Games and International Tours: Leagues and teams capitalize on the global appeal of their young stars by organizing international exhibition games and tours, further cementing their global footprint.
  6. Multilingual Content Creation: To cater to diverse international fan bases, teams and leagues increasingly produce content in multiple languages, often featuring their global next-gen talents.

The Demands of Elite Sport

Despite their immense talent, next-gen talents face significant challenges in ensuring longevity and sustained success in the physically and mentally demanding world of professional sports.

Challenges Facing Next-Gen Talents:

  1. Injury Risk: Early specialization and intense training loads at a young age can increase the risk of overuse injuries and burnout. Managing their physical development and preventing injuries are paramount.
  2. Burnout and Mental Fatigue: The relentless pressure, constant travel, and demands of professional sports can lead to mental fatigue and burnout, especially for young athletes who are still developing their coping mechanisms.
  3. Managing Expectations: The immense hype surrounding young stars can create unrealistic expectations, leading to immense pressure and disappointment if they don’t immediately meet those lofty predictions.
  4. Adaptation to Pro Level: Transitioning from amateur to professional competition involves a significant leap in physicality, speed, and strategic complexity. Not all promising talents successfully make this adaptation.
  5. Financial Management: Sudden wealth at a young age can present challenges in financial management. Professional guidance is essential to ensure long-term financial stability.
  6. Maintaining Motivation: After achieving early success, maintaining the same level of hunger and motivation over a long career, especially through periods of adversity, can be difficult.
  7. Personal Growth and Life Skills: While focused on athletic development, young stars also need support in developing life skills, managing relationships, and navigating personal challenges that come with fame and success.
  8. The “Sophomore Slump” or Regression: After an initial strong season, some young players experience a “slump” as opponents adjust to their game. Overcoming this requires adaptability and continuous development.

Support Systems and Best Practices

To maximize the potential and ensure the well-being of next-gen talents, a comprehensive and integrated support system is crucial.

Essential Support Systems for Young Stars:

  1. Holistic Development Programs: Academies and teams are increasingly adopting holistic approaches that integrate athletic training with academic support, life skills development, and mental health services, recognizing the athlete as a whole person.
  2. Mentorship from Veterans: Pairing young talents with experienced veteran players can provide invaluable guidance on navigating the demands of professional sports, managing expectations, and maintaining longevity.
  3. Sports Psychology and Mental Performance Coaching: Providing access to sports psychologists helps young athletes manage pressure, develop coping strategies, enhance focus, and build mental resilience crucial for long-term success.
  4. Physiotherapy and Injury Prevention Specialists: Dedicated medical and performance teams focus on proactive injury prevention, load management, and rapid, effective rehabilitation to ensure the physical health and longevity of young athletes.
  5. Nutrition and Dietetics: Personalized nutrition plans tailored to the specific needs of growing bodies and demanding training regimens are essential for optimal performance, recovery, and injury prevention.
  6. Financial and Legal Advisory: Providing early and ongoing education and professional advice on financial management, contract negotiation, and legal matters helps young athletes make informed decisions and secure their futures.
  7. Coaching and Tactical Development: Coaches play a critical role in continually refining technical skills, enhancing strategic understanding, and ensuring the young athlete’s game continues to evolve to meet higher competitive standards.
  8. Parental and Family Support: The continued support and guidance from family remain critical. Education for parents on navigating the complexities of elite youth sports can prevent undue pressure or exploitation.

Inspiring Generations

The impact of next-gen talents extends far beyond their immediate performances; they become symbols of aspiration, driving cultural narratives and inspiring future generations.

The Lasting Legacy of Next-Gen Talent:

  1. New Role Models: Young stars become instant role models for aspiring athletes, demonstrating that with dedication and talent, dreams can be realized, inspiring millions to pursue their own passions.
  2. Driving Fan Engagement: Their exciting play and compelling personal stories attract new fans to sports, rejuvenating fan bases and ensuring the sport’s continued popularity for decades to come.
  3. Pushing Human Performance Limits: By consistently challenging existing records and introducing new techniques, next-gen talents continually redefine the boundaries of human athletic potential, inspiring innovation across all sports.
  4. Shaping Sports Culture: Their unique personalities, social media presence, and engagement with fans contribute to the evolving culture of sports, making it more dynamic, relatable, and globally interconnected.
  5. Catalyst for Innovation: Their demands for optimized training, advanced recovery, and personalized data insights drive continuous innovation in sports science and technology, benefiting athletes at all levels.
  6. Economic Growth and Investment: Their marketability and on-field success attract significant investment into sports, leading to increased league revenues, team valuations, and job creation across the industry.
  7. Global Inspiration: Young talents from diverse backgrounds inspire their home nations and communities, showcasing pathways to success and fostering national pride through their global achievements.

The continuous emergence of next-gen talents is the lifeblood of professional sports. They are the innovators, the record-breakers, and the future icons who will shape the competitive landscape for years to come. By understanding the forces that create them, the challenges they face, and the immense impact they wield, we can better appreciate their journeys and celebrate their pivotal role in the enduring appeal and ongoing evolution of global athletics. Their rise guarantees that the most exciting chapters of sports history are yet to be written.
